???? The Strategic Location of Mirpur 1
Where Exactly Is Mirpur 1 Dhaka?
Mirpur 1 is part of the larger Mirpur area, which falls under the Dhaka North City Corporation. It's located in the northern part of Dhaka and serves as a vital transit hub connecting Gabtoli, Pallabi, Kazipara, and Agargaon.

????️ Housing and Living Standards
What Types of Homes You’ll Find
Whether you're a bachelor looking for a shared mess, a student renting a studio, or a family searching for a multi-bedroom apartment—Mirpur 1 has it all.
Cost of Living and Rent Breakdown
Mess/bachelor: BDT 3,500–6,000/month
Small flat: BDT 8,000–12,000/month
Family apartment: BDT 15,000–25,000/month
Utilities and groceries are fairly budget-friendly compared to Gulshan or Dhanmondi.
???? Mirpur 1 and the Metro Rail Boom
How Metro Rail Changed Everything
The Metro Rail station at Mirpur 1 has made a huge difference. Travel times are down, businesses are booming, and the area is more connected than ever.
Connectivity With the Rest of Dhaka
From Mirpur 1, you can reach Motijheel, Uttara, and Farmgate quickly and easily, skipping all the traffic chaos.
